And Xue Yongli's cavalry training also began the training of weapons. At the beginning of the training, Xue Yongli proposed to Wu Shigong: to prepare some wooden sticks, these wooden sticks do not need to be very hard, and the more brittle, the better. These sticks were used to make the cavalry's riding spears.
After listening to Xue Yongli's explanation, Wu Shigong knew. When the cavalry used weapons, they did not wield sabers and play spears at all in movies and TV series.
The power of the cavalry is the speed and momentum of the horse, so when encountering the enemy, the cavalry always raises the speed of the horse at this time. Therefore, the cavalry at this time must not use their weapons to fight the enemy. Otherwise, you will be shocked and fall off your horse, or even fractured by the shock.
Xue Yongli was afraid that Wu Shigong would not understand, so he explained a lot of words over and over again. However, as soon as Wu Shigong heard Xue Yongli's words, he knew this truth.
In modern times, although Wu Shigong did not graduate from junior high school, he still knows the "Three Laws of Newton". This principle is the action force and the reaction force.
Xue Yongli then explained to Wu Shigong that when the cavalry uses the saber on the horse, it only needs to follow the fast edge of the saber, rely on the speed of the horse, and gently take the enemy's vital point. It's all about ingenuity. As for the chopping action on the horse, it is only when the cavalry has rushed into the enemy's array and the horse's speed has slowed down.
And the cavalry spear is a completely disposable weapon for cavalry. The cavalry spear only came into play when the cavalry charged the enemy line. When the horses are moving at high speed, the cavalry can pierce a hole in the enemy's body with a wooden stick in his hand. It can be seen how huge this liliang is.
When a cavalryman charges with a spear, he must not grasp the spear with his hands, but hold it in his hands. As soon as the tip of the spear touches the enemy's body, the hand of the cavalry is to release the spear.
And the wood used for the shaft of the spear is also as brittle as possible. In this way, the cavalry spear will break, and the counterattack force on the cavalry will be relatively small. In this way, the cavalry can be guaranteed not to be knocked off their horses by this liliang.
